Baseball Recap: Coventry Comets vs. East Dragons

In what's become a running theme this season, Coventry gave their fans yet another huge win on Saturday. Their pitchers stepped up to hand the East Dragons a 14-0 shutout. The victory made it back-to-back wins for Coventry.

Evan Owen was a major factor while hitting and pitching. He tossed two innings while giving up no earned runs or hits. Owen was also solid in the batter's box, scoring two runs and stealing a base while going 1-for-2.

In other pitching news, Basinger Cody looked comfortable as he struck out seven batters over three innings while giving up no earned runs or hits (and not a single walk).

Back at the plate, Coventry let Landon Moritz and Ryan Snyder loose on the outfield. Moritz scored two runs while going 3-for-4, while Snyder scored two runs and stole a base while going 1-for-3. The team also got some help courtesy of Chris Esterak, who scored two runs and stole a base while going 2-for-3.

Coventry now has a winning record of 4-3. As for East, they are on a nine-game losing streak (dating back to last season) that has dropped them down to 0-2.

Coventry will be playing in front of their home fans against Cloverleaf at 5: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Coventry is strutting in with some hitting muscle, as they've averaged 8.6 runs per game this season. As for East, they will be playing at home against Ellet at 5: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
